On Thursday, November 17, 2011, the ICWA Law Center is hosting a benefit event at Open Book, 1011 Washington Avenue South, Mpls, MN 55415.

Please join us for hors d'oeuvres (courtesy of Lucia's), drinks, and entertainment provided by local American Indian writers: Heid Erdrich (Ojibwe), Emily Johnson (Yupik), Jay Bad Heart Bull (Lakota), and Bobby Wilson (Dakota). The reception will begin at 6pm and the program will start at 7pm. We will also have a silent auction at the event with items donated by local artists, businesses and law firms.

All proceeds from the event will go toward supporting the ICWA Law Center, a non-profit legal services provider for low-income American Indian families with case impacted by the Indian Child Welfare Act.
